Output 51cb27c83180d5516c4492f57ab95ce50f9f12877d6723cf1f3ef7834aa4018b:5

value
6299705
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44f62180c2eb45b080433ef61d4edc2680a825a8 OP_EQUALVERIFY OP_CHECKSIG
address
17HdoWzqmrjn177HDChRCk1qLq1EWEVfoK
transaction
51cb27c83180d5516c4492f57ab95ce50f9f12877d6723cf1f3ef7834aa4018b
spent
true